Vertical Access provide Refresher Courses for those IRATA technicians who are in
need of renewing their certification.
A refresher course is needed if no rope work has been done for 6 months or more and
also if the ticket is about to expire. (Please note if a ticket has expired a full
5 day course will need to be completed). To ensure technicians are up to date with
certification, re-assessment may be done up to 6 months before expiry date without
time penalty.
The refresher course lasts a minimum of 3 days depending on the individuals rope
access experience.
